React Native Guide - Firebase

Contains ads
500+
Downloads
Content rating
Everyone
Screenshot image
Screenshot image
Screenshot image
Screenshot image
Screenshot image
Screenshot image
Screenshot image
Screenshot image
Screenshot image
Screenshot image
Screenshot image
Screenshot image
Screenshot image
Screenshot image
Screenshot image
Screenshot image
Screenshot image
Screenshot image
Screenshot image
Screenshot image
Screenshot image

About this app

Hello,

■ This app provides you with complete guidance and a live demonstration of how Built with Firebase features work in react native CLI (bare workflow) in Android apps

■ Why is an expo not used?

Because in this project I use custom native code and modules, the expo is not capable to handle this.

■ Key features of this App

1. Authentication

• Sign in with email and password
• Sign up with email and password
• Forget Password (Reset Password)
• Anonymous Sign in
• Phone Number
• Facebook
• Twitter
• Google

2. Firestore

• Create Collections
• Create document (custom & random UID)
• Delete document
• Update document
• Read document
• Querying Data
• Transaction Data
• Many other

3. Storage

• Upload image files
• Delete specific files
• Read specific files
• Read specific folder
• Generate file download link
• Read a list of data

4. Test Lab

• Provides guidance
• How to upload the app and select devices to test .apk, .aab, or .ipa files with a specific option
• Select the test type
• How to read details of test results

5. App Distribution

• Upload .apk file
• Upload .aab file
• Create testers
• Create a testers group
• Create an invitation link
• Restric on specific domains

6. Cloud Messaging (Push Notification)

• Setup foreground state
• Setup background state
• Setup while the user uses the application

7. In-app Messaging

8. FCM Tokens

• How to generate FCM token
• Copy your device FCM token

9. Security Rules

• Set access to a specific user
• Apply restrictions on specific user
• Apply rules on specific files/folder
• Apply Limit upload file size
• Apply to limit specific file type
• Apply rules to read, and write only authenticated users
• Many more...

■ I provide you my GitHub link in-app so you can check out the complete source code and also I provide important code in-app for a better understanding

■ Your guidance will always be welcomed if you found any mistake in this app, contact me

Thank you
Updated on
Jun 8, 2025

Data safety

Safety starts with understanding how developers collect and share your data. Data privacy and security practices may vary based on your use, region, and age. The developer provided this information and may update it over time.
No data shared with third parties
Learn more about how developers declare sharing
This app may collect these data types
Personal info
Data is encrypted in transit
You can request that data be deleted

App support

About the developer
Muhammad Jahanzeb
jahanzebsupp@gmail.com
Street # 2, House # 87, Sargodha, Punjab Sargodha, 40100 Pakistan
undefined

More by Hunte Tech